Just like the previous model, this camera works by wirelessly streaming video from the camera to other devices such as laptops, desktops, virtually any kind o' top! Using motionEyeOS, you can connect with the device's IP address, and peep on creeps from the comfort of your home! (Version 3 should have it's camera upgraded to Pi Camera V2 or Pi NoIR V2) The IPi V3 takes the best features of V1.5 and V2. Version 1.5 had an accessible MicroSD card, and could swivel on all axis, but the ball and socket wore out fast and it became too loose. Version 2 has a sturdier base, swiveling was simplified, and the camera stayed in it's pointed position. Unfortunately it could only swivel side to side, and the MicroSD card was inaccessible. Version 3 has an arm that rotates and allows the camera to pitch while staying in its pointed position. The MicroSD card is also accessible. Because of these features, the base can be mounted in any position! Due to the design intent on security, the IPi V2 should be printed in a color the closely matches it's surroundings, or at least Black, to make it more difficult to see in darker environments.
